About Us

Building North Dakota’s economic future through leadership, technology, and women’s business development.

Center for Technology & Business (CTB) is a 501(c)(3) founded in 1999 in Bismarck, North Dakota. Our initial goal was to develop simplified computer materials for use in rural small businesses and to teach business owners to utilize technology as a business tool. Since that time, more than 21,000 rural North Dakotans have learned how to use computers, hooked up to the Internet, and significantly increased rural employment options. The economic impact to the state and our rural communities has been phenomenal!

Over the last decade, CTB has grown to facilitate many diverse programs based on technology and business development needs across North Dakota.

Our programming includes

Women's Business Center

CTB operates the women’s business center program for North Dakota, a partnership funded by the US Small Business Administration and the ND Department of Commerce. MasterMinds

CTB runs MasterMinds, a program focused on providing a framework for networking and professional development for women business owners across North Dakota.


Technology Training

CTB provides computer training and technical assistance to businesses and individuals across the state of North Dakota. Through “Train the Trainer” certification seminars, local trainers learn to provide instruction for adults of all ages in an easy-going, non-threatening manner. 


North Dakota Rural Development Council

CTB facilitates the Rural Development Council by providing a forum and network through which issues, projects and activities pertinent to rural residents are acted upon.


North Dakota Young Professionals Network

CTB coordinates NDYP, a statewide network dedicated to advancing opportunities for young professionals across North Dakota.


Crash Course 

CTB partners with NDCAN to hold hands-on learning seminars throughout North Dakota that provide information on local career opportunities, college readiness and financial planning for families of students in grades 7-12.
